• I just wanted new posts on our sports club site to be automatically posted to our Facebook page. Seems I have to buy a “Premium” subscription to enable that? Our traffic is way too low to justify that I’m afraid…

  • The description section has:

    “for cross-posting and auto posting
    *?Facebook?– Post to your profile, page (Free), and in groups (Premium)”

    It is in fact a misleading/false statement. It forces to subscribe to premium version for auto posting, even for the Facebook.

    I deleted the plugin and used Jetpack instead – which gives you 30 free social media posts a month, which is more than enough for us. ??

    Blog2Social offers a wide range of automation and customizing options in the free version and you can share your posts to Facebook as well as across multiple social media accounts with one click automatically. Cross-posting is free for your Facebook page as well as on many other social platforms.

    You can easily achieve your goal by clicking on “Social Media Posts” in your Blog2Social dashboard. Here you can see all of your published WordPress posts. By clicking on “Share on Social Media” next to your preferred post, you can customize and share it on all your connected networks.

    However, to ensure compliance with the new API rules of the social networks, some advanced functions of the auto-posting and auto-scheduling features are provided in the Premium versions.

    But take a close look at all the things you can do with the free version of Blog2Social.
    For example:
    -Share your posts or pages on 13 different social networks at once: Twitter, Facebook (profile and page), LinkedIn (profile), XING (profile), Pinterest, Reddit, Torial, Medium, Tumblr, Flickr, Diigo, Bloglovin and VK
    -Customize your social media posts with personal comments, hashtags, handles, emojis, and select an image of your choice from your blog post. You can even edit the complete HTML markup for re-publishing your post on Tumblr, Torial, and Medium.
    -View all your social media posts in one single place.
    -Automatically generate hashtags from the tags of your post.
    -Edit the meta tag information of your blog posts and pages.
    -Use the free Blog2Social Extension for Firefox and Chrome to save links while browsing and share them whenever you want.
